Well you landed in Mumbai, now what

1. First walk out of the terminal, you’ll see a number of people waiting to receive someone or the other
2. Start looking for a person holding a board with your name on it
a) if you are booked at a hotel in Mumbai, this person will be there from the hotel to pick you up. You should then have someone pick you up for your Pune travel the next day (mentioned in step 1.d.iv above)
b) if you are to directly go to Pune, this person will be your driver (arranged by XYZ) to take you to Pune (mentioned in step 1.d.iv above)
3. Your first day at Pune office – you should plan to come to office not before 10 am.
